Visualizzazione dei risultati da 1 a 2 su 2

Discussione: Sound Mp3

  1. #1

    Sound Mp3

    Ciao a tutti raga
    Come al solito ho un problema
    Sto caricando il sound per un filmato flash esternamente da un file mp3.. e vorrei creare 2 pulsanti che al click mi danno la possibilità di aumentare o diminuire il volume sonoro del file mp3 e nn so come fare
    Mi potreste aiutare perfavore?
    Il file mp3 lo carico tramite questa action trovata per la rete :

    bar.bar._xscale = 0;
    s = new Sound(this);
    s.onLoad = function(success){
    if(success){
    s.start(0, 999999);
    output.text = "Sound complete";
    }else{
    output.text = "Failed to load sound";
    _global.soundLoading = false;
    }
    };
    function startSound(){
    s.loadSound("sound1.mp3", false);
    _global.soundLoading = true;
    }

    this.onEnterFrame = function(){
    if(soundLoading){
    var car = s.getBytesLoaded();
    var tot = s.getBytesTotal();
    if(car != undefined && car > 100){
    var perc = int((car*100)/tot);
    this.bar.bar._xscale = perc;
    this.output.text = "loading sound " + perc + "%";
    if(car >= tot){
    _global.soundLoading = false;
    delete this.onEnterFrame;
    }
    }
    }
    };

    startSound();

    grazie a tutti quelli che mi aiuteranno.
    Andiamo Avanti Ole!!

  2. #2
    prova a mettere queste due function:

    codice:
    function alzaVolume(){
    	var vol = s.getVolume();
    	if(vol < 100){
    		vol+=5;
    		s.setVolume(vol);
    	}
    }
    function abassaVolume(){
    	var vol = s.getVolume();
    	if(vol > 0){
    		vol-=5;
    		s.setVolume(vol);
    	}
    }
    e questo per i pulsanti:

    codice:
    pulsAlza.onPress = function(){
    	a = setInterval(alzaVolume,50);
    }
    pulsAlza.onRelease = pulsAlza.onReleaseOutside = function(){
    	clearInterval(a);
    }
    pulsAbbassa.onPress = function(){
    	b = setInterval(abbassaVolume,50);
    }
    pulsAbbassa.onRelease = pulsAbbassa.onReleaseOutside = function(){
    	clearInterval(b);
    }
    dove pulsAlza e pulsAbbassa sono i nomi di istanza dei pulsanti per alzare e abbassare il volume.

    cmq non l'ho provato

    regalami un oggi da favola...e il domani bhe!?non mi importa se tu 6 con me! ©Ily

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.